More pages, more and more, all of them have changed!
“Come on Willow, the bell went 10 minutes ago, your mum is waiting for you outside! I don’t want you here anymore.”

Miss Beatrice is my teacher, she absolutely hates me. No one really likes me anyway, except for my younger sister Julia. I decided to live with my mum after my parents divorced about a year or two ago. My sister is always near me and it’s my job to look after her because my mum is always working so she barely even sees us. I hope she loves me, even though she is always at work. The only time I see her is when she picks me up from school and sometimes at dinner.

“WILLOW! Are you even listening to me? I don’t want you here anymore, I need to get some work done!” My teacher yelled at me. I think the teachers in the other room went quiet as well. “I WON’T! My mum can wait, she has all da-.” The next minute I woke up in my bedroom with my mum over me, checking my temperature and covering my face with ice packs. I must have fainted when I yelled at Miss Beatrice because I don’t really yell, and that was the loudest I’ve done so. I wanted to leave the classroom, I don’t know why I stayed. I’ve been feeling a little off lately. Just as I got up, Julia, my younger sister rushed into my room and jumped on my bed. “Are you alright sissy? I heard you screamed what’s wrong? Can you still play with me? What can I do?” Julia talks a lot if you can’t already tell, and it’s a bit hard to calm her down especially in a situation like this. “Yes yes, I’m alright. Just give me a bit to rest then we can play! Sounds good?” In a blink of an eye, my sister ran out of my bedroom to let me be. Pretty good huh. Mum follows after her, then I slowly start to lay down until I spot something on my bedside table.

It’s a book but without a cover, title or colour. It’s huge and covered in what looks like black ink. I open a few pages and black ink is splashed all over pictures. There is one page that is folded, but doesn’t have any ink on it and I can see the picture there very clearly. Two people were standing there, laughing and having the best time of their lives. Until I realised who it was. It was my mum and dad. Before they had divorced. More and more pictures of them having the best time. Then the last page, my dad laughing with another woman and my mum crying. I touched the picture and heard something from downstairs. Julia comes running into my room telling me mum’s crying! Tears form, my dad disappears. It’s the book, not dad. But how…
